1. AT100
Let’s start our selection with the AT1000 tool designed for viticulture and Forestry experts. As an electric tying machine, it could gain popularity in France, which has a significant 797,000 hectares of Vineyards as of 2020, second only to Spain. The AT100 tool is built to last, managing up to 8,000 ties on one charge. It’s also quite lightweight at 615 grams excluding the battery. AT100 is easy to upkeep, has a comfortable grip, and has a large wire reel capacity. It’s set to hit the shelves later 2023.

5. Cavdle WasteCycler
A couple of years ago, the UN figured out that over 900 million tons of food get tossed globally each year. That’s a lot. The creators of this composter got the right idea: why waste when you can recycle? You load in food leftovers. fruits and veggie peels, fish bones, and even coffee grounds, and the Machine churns out compost. It’s got nine modes, with the quickest one pre-composting 500 milliliters of waste in two hours, perfect for a three-person family. It’s dishwasher safe, and smells are a no-go thanks to the deodorizing setup. It’s priced at 270 dollars.

12. BatBnB
Consider having bats on your property as a more effective way to fend off mosquitoes than other insects. A single bat can consume numerous insects each night, including mosquitoes, flies, cockroaches, ants, and midges. The idea is simple. invest around 140 in this bat house to welcome a winged neighbor. You might even attract more than one as the house can accommodate up to 50 bats thanks to its dimensions of 79 by 43 centimeters. Minimal screws and nails are used, ensuring the safety of the bats. The pre-assembled house is easy to mound on various wooden surfaces thanks to its versatile fastening system.
13. BurgonBall Kneelo® Gardening Kneelers and Knee Pads
Gardening often means kneeling, which can be tough on your knees. The truth is, knee joints are sensitive and susceptible to Cold ground. To prevent issues like arthritis, these foam-based knee pads were created. This model includes a core of EVA foam for shock absorption encased in two layers of memory foam and a protective nylon-coated neoprene layer. This one has a length of 52 centimeters, providing ample space for both knees. The cost for either option is 22 dollars.
